Constantine A. Balanis, Regents' Professor of Electrical Engineering at Arizona State University, brings his extensive academic and NASA research background to this authoritative book. With degrees from Virginia Tech, University of Virginia, and Ohio State, plus decades of teaching and research, Balanis draws on deep expertise to present antenna theory with clarity and depth. His status as a life fellow of the IEEE underscores the trustworthiness of this work for anyone serious about antenna engineering.

What happens when a seasoned electrical engineer with decades of academic and NASA research experience turns to antenna theory? Constantine A. Balanis provides a thorough exploration of antenna principles, guiding you through the analysis, design, and measurement of various antenna structures—from linear dipoles to microstrip and reflector antennas. You'll find detailed mathematical explanations supported by color illustrations and practical examples, including newer topics like antenna miniaturization and mobile communication antennas. This book suits you if you're tackling antenna engineering at an advanced undergraduate or graduate level, or if you're a practicing engineer seeking a solid technical reference.

What happens when the leading amateur radio association compiles decades of expertise into a single volume? ARRL Inc. presents a detailed exploration of antenna theory and construction that goes beyond basics. You’ll learn how signals propagate, specific designs for dipoles, loops, and beams, and methods to tailor antennas for frequencies from HF to microwave bands. The book dives into practical updates like terrain profiling for site selection and troubleshooting antenna tuners, making it a solid technical guide. If you’re passionate about hands-on antenna building or refining your radio setup, this book offers a deep well of knowledge but might be dense for casual hobbyists.

Eric P. Nichols is a recognized authority in amateur radio and antenna design, contributing significantly through his extensive experience and publications. His approachable style makes complex concepts about receiving antennas accessible, driven by a desire to help amateur radio operators improve their station’s performance especially on challenging low bands.
2018·256 pages·Antennas, Radio Communications, Signal Reception, Active Antennas, Antenna Design

Eric P. Nichols, a well-regarded expert in amateur radio and antenna design, crafted this book to address the unique challenges of receiving antennas distinct from transmitting ones. You’ll gain a deep understanding of how active and passive receiving antennas function, including the role of low-noise RF operational amplifiers in improving signal reception. The book walks you through practical topics like the design of small loop antennas, the Beverage antenna’s unique characteristics, and techniques for achieving perfect nulls, all essential for enhancing your station’s receiving capability. Whether you’re focused on low-frequency bands or exploring new allocations like 630 and 2200 meters, this book offers targeted insights that help you optimize your receiving setup effectively.

Peter Parker is an experienced amateur radio operator who has spent decades building and experimenting with antennas. His journey began in 1980 with the construction of a crystal set, leading to a novice license in 1986. Over the years, he has developed numerous projects, including transceivers and antennas, and has authored several books aimed at helping both beginners and experienced operators. His practical knowledge and hands-on approach make his works valuable resources for anyone interested in amateur radio.
2020·184 pages·Antennas, Radio Operation, QRP Techniques, HF Bands, VHF

Drawing from nearly 30 years of hands-on experience in QRP amateur radio, Peter Parker dives deep into portable antenna design with this follow-up to his earlier work. You’ll explore over thirty tested antenna projects, ranging from low HF bands to upper HF, VHF, and UHF frequencies, each accompanied by practical insights and a touch of theory. The book’s detailed attention to simple, buildable antennas and accessories makes it a solid fit if you’re looking to expand your portable operating capabilities beyond the basics. Whether you’re a seasoned builder or looking to refine your antenna setup for varied bands, this volume offers grounded, practical options without unnecessary complexity.
